Transaction 38d6a1b4f79f5a9371a88b3c365c746e3d9f4fe298c7f263510cb6a799531d46

24 Input
1 Outputs
  • 38d6a1b4f79f5a9371a88b3c365c746e3d9f4fe298c7f263510cb6a799531d46:0
  • value  50779277
    address  12PXUswZ1DdwtCmb99tw2Qvz9QBH4mQPsH